About this book

This book primarily focuses on nanomaterial synthesis, properties, sensor fabrication, and their uses for disease diagnosis and therapy. Major topics covered include synthesis of different dimensional nanomaterials, characterizations and analysis of nanomaterials, procedure for non-invasive disease diagnosis, and measurement principles of medical devices or sensor devices. It also illustrates state-of-the-art nanomaterials for drug delivery supported by practical examples and case studies.

Features:

Explores different dimensional (0D, 1D, 2D, 3D) nanomaterial synthesis techniques.

Introduces various nanomaterials for fabrication sensors.

Discusses the applications of sensors in disease diagnostics and therapy.

Covers nanomaterial characterizations techniques such as XRD, FESEM, AFM, and TEM.

Describes state of the art nanomaterials for drug delivery.

This book is aimed at graduate students and researchers in materials science, nanomaterials, sensors, and biosensors.
